1. Coinbase Global, Inc. ($COIN) As one of the leading cryptocurrency exchanges, Coinbase has been at the forefront of the crypto boom. The rise of tokens like WLFI could lead to increased trading activity on platforms like Coinbase, impacting their revenue positively. Investors should watch how Coinbase adapts to the fluctuating crypto landscape.
2. Block, Inc. ($SQ) Previously known as Square, Block is a payment processing company that has heavily invested in cryptocurrency. With the rise of tokens and digital currencies, Block's integration of crypto payments could see significant growth, making it a stock to consider for those looking to capitalize on the crypto boom.
3. Tesla, Inc. ($TSLA) Tesla's CEO, Elon Musk, has been a vocal supporter of cryptocurrency. The electric car maker has even accepted Bitcoin for vehicle purchases in the past. As the market for digital currencies expands, Tesla might look to leverage crypto further, potentially influencing its stock price and appeal among investors.
4. Microsoft Corporation ($MSFT) Microsoft has begun to explore applications of blockchain technology, which underpins cryptocurrencies. As the sector grows, companies like Microsoft could find new revenue streams through blockchain solutions, making them an interesting stock for investors looking to tie into the crypto narrative.
5. Nvidia Corporation ($NVDA) Known for its graphics processing units (GPUs), Nvidia has seen increased demand from cryptocurrency miners. The growth of cryptocurrencies could continue to drive sales of Nvidia's products, impacting its stock performance favorably as more investors look to enter the crypto space.
